This emblem represents Amfibiekåren (the Swedish Amphibious Corps) the coastal defence arm of the Swedish Navy, built for operations in the archipelago and littoral environment. The Amphibious Corps was formed in 2000 as the successor to the Swedish Coastal Artillery (Kustartilleriet), reflecting a shift from static coastal batteries to more mobile amphibious units.
Today, Sweden’s amphibious forces (centered around Amf 1) train and operate with a mix of marine infantry, coastal rangers, and specialized coastal capabilities designed to control key maritime approaches and defend Sweden’s coastline.
The Torleif figure is closely tied to amphibious tradition and unit identity (a soldier-created symbol that has lived on in amphibious culture), paired here with the classic anchor to underline the Corps’ naval connection.
